The 1930 Brown Bears football team represented Brown University during the 1930 college football season.[1][2]

Schedule[]

DateOpponentSiteResult
Rhode IslandW 7–0
WPIW 54–0
PrincetonW 7–0
YaleL 0–21
Holy CrossW 13–0
SyracuseT 16–16
TuftsW 32–7
ColumbiaW 6–0
New HampshireL 0–7
ColgateL 0–27
